Managing payroll is one of the most critical functions in any business; even a small error can lead to financial strain and employee dissatisfaction. With complex regulations, varying pay structures, and different types of employees, choosing the right payroll software has never been more important or challenging.
Given these difficulties, this guide will highlight the must-have features and evaluation criteria of the best payroll software. Whether you are selecting a first payroll system or upgrading from an outdated one, understanding what works well for your organization will help you make an informed decision.
Payroll can be a major challenge for your distributed team, where compensation structures, tax regulations, and compliance requirements vary by location. When you handle these complexities manually, it increases the risk of errors, delays, and regulatory gaps. An efficient payroll system in place addresses these challenges by:
- Automating payroll processes to save time and minimize manual errors
- Supporting flexible payment methods and multicurrency transactions
- Ensuring multi-state and multi-jurisdiction compliance
- Providing visibility into payroll tasks and employee data
Having payroll software helps you eradicate repetitive tasks, maintain consistent, accurate pay cycles, and reduce costly mistakes. It helps in keeping employees satisfied and ensures compliance requirements are fully met.

When comparing several payroll software options, focus on the following must-have capabilities of the system that can truly make a difference in your day-to-day operations:
Automated Payroll Processing
Pick software that will automatically calculate wages, overtime, reimbursements, bonuses, and deductions. You need to make sure that it processes paychecks on time, improving employee satisfaction.
Tax Filing And Compliance
It is important to go with a solution that has built-in tax tables for federal, state, and local tax calculations. The system should be able to generate W-2 forms, simplify tax filings, and automatically update with regulatory changes. Ensure it complies with labor laws and tax regulations across each jurisdiction where your business operates.
Self-Service Portals
Through self-service portals, you can empower employees to view their pay slips, download tax documents, update personal details, and track deductions in real time. This not only improves employee satisfaction, but it also frees HR teams from routine clerical tasks, so they can work on strategic priorities.
Direct Deposits And Payment Options
Compare tools and select the one that supports fast direct deposits and flexible payment methods such as split deposits, pay cards, and digital transfers. These features eliminate the need for manual checks, prevent payout errors, and ensure employees are paid on time.
Integration Capabilities
Select software that integrates well with your existing Human Resources (HR) systems, time-tracking tools, and accounting software. This connection enables clear visibility into labor costs, smooth data flow, and efficient payroll management.
Payroll Auditing And Reports
Look for systems that provide detailed auditing tools and customizable reporting features. It will enable you to analyze expense reports, tax liability summaries, labor cost analytics, and compliance documentation. These insights help prevent unnecessary expenses, support budgeting decisions, and provide full operational visibility.
Nhlaka Mncube, director at CFO360, said, "Payroll visibility helps spot trends in workforce costs and give strategic advice on workforce planning."
This quick overview will help you make an informed decision depending on your needs, size, and requirements.
Software | Ratings | Trial Info | Best For | Starting Price | Unique Features |
4.5/5
| Trial available (Free up to two consecutive billing cycles)
| Small to mid-sized businesses | Starting from $49/month + $6/person
| • Automated tax filings • Autopilot payroll runs • Gusto debit card | |
| 4/5
| Free trial available
| Growing businesses
| Custom pricing
| • Multi-state payroll • Payroll submission via phone or specialist • Advanced garnishment payment processing
|
| 4.9/5
| 14-day free trial
| Tech forward companies
| Starting at $8/user/month + $40/month base fee
| • Compensation bands • Global EOR • Customizable pay types
|
4.4/5
| N/A
| Mid-sized to large companies | Custom pricing
| • 200 pre-built reports & dashboards • Smart alerts + built-in error detection • Automated GL export for accounting | |
4.4/5
| 30-day free trial
| Businesses that already use QuickBooks and want all-in-one payroll solution | Starting from $50/month + $6.50/employee
| • Workforce portal • Integrated HR and benefits management • Contractor payments |

When selecting payroll software, consider the following step-by-step methodology that will equip you with a structured evaluation process:
- Define Your Payroll Goals: Identify your company’s needs, employee working patterns, and locations. Ask whether you need multi-state payroll, contractor support, or advanced reporting. This helps you select the system that matches your operational needs
- Consider Ease Of Use: Choose a system offering clean interface, easy navigation, simple setup, and structured processes. Test it via free trial or a demo to assess how easy the system is to use
- Assess Capabilities: Opt for a system that supports your workflows and reduces manual workload through features such as built-in time tracking, self-service portal, reporting dashboard, automated tax handling, and direct deposit
- Assess Customer Support: Look for providers that offer real-time onboarding support and make assistance available through live chats, phones, and dedicated payroll specialists to resolve issues quickly
- Review Scalability: Select a system that can support workforce growth, multi-state operations, and complex pay structures to ensure long-term reliability without adding costly upgrades and system migration
Common Mistakes To Avoid
When choosing the payroll system, avoid the following pitfalls to ensure your payroll system becomes a strategic advantage, not a recurring problem:
- Picking a vendor that doesn't fit your business requirements
- Failing to check if the payroll software is tax-compliant and follows the local labor laws
- Choosing the software solely based on cost may land you in trouble later
- Neglecting data security will lead to sensitive information breach
The right payroll system transforms the way your business operates, improves accuracy, and keeps you compliant. When you understand your needs and compare essential features, you will be better equipped to choose a system that works for your team and continues to support as the organization scales.
